The sternoclavicular (SC) joint is the linkage between the clavicle (collarbone) and the sternum (breastbone). The SC joint supports the shoulder and is the only joint that connects the arm to the body. Like the other joints in the body, the SC joint is covered with a smooth, slippery substance called articular cartilage.

WebMar 24, 2024 · The humerus is the upper arm bone. It is divided into the head, anatomic neck, surgical neck, and shaft. The head of the humerus forms the ball portion of the ball-and-socket like glenohumeral joint. Just below the anatomic neck are the greater and lesser tuberosities, where the muscles of the rotator cuff attach to. WebThe shoulder is made up of two joints, the acromioclavicular joint and the glenohumeral joint. The acromioclavicular joint is where the acromion, part of the shoulder blade (scapula) and the collar bone (clavicle) meet. The glenohumeral joint is where the ball (humeral head) and the socket (the glenoid) meet.
